February 22, 2008 – 11:40 pmIf you find the whole PRINCE2 process a bit too complex for your project. If you believe you do not need a whole project board and your budget does not allow for the whole conundrum. Patrick Mayfield from pearcemayfield writes on the pmtoolbox web site about workshops on what he calls other flavors of PRINCE2. Less oriented towards the certification and more focused on the practicability of project management
Foundations of Project Management which integrates general skills with using Microsoft Project
Practical Project Management, for a hands-on emphasis, learning by doing,
Complete Project Management for an immersion in comprehensive project management principles and techniques.
Similarly, the PRINCE lite framework was conceived as a mix between PRINCE2, RUP and the original waterfall.
I have also found that implementing the whole PRINCE2 by the book is a bit exagerated when you are managing a 70k€ project with 1 supplier and nobody else but your direct boss to report to. I just could not find anyone to take on the role of Project Assurance or Senior Customer or Senior User.
